Thornbridge to open flagship bar in Sheffield
Thornbridge & Co is readying its next venue, The Fargate.
Sheffield city centre will soon welcome the arrival of The Fargate, a new flagship bar from brewer and pub operator Thornbridge & Co.
Named after its setting, The Fargate joins other Thornbridge & Co’s venues the Market Cat in York, Bankers Cat in Leeds and The Colmore in Birmingham. Doors will officially open on 22 October.
The new venue brings together the look of the former Yorkshire Bank (previously the Yorkshire Penny Savings Bank) with a newly designed pub interior.
It will feature dark polished wood, leather seating, herringbone floors, brass accents, chandeliers and curated artwork.
At its heart is a horseshoe bar serving 10 cask ales, half of them Thornbridge, as well as 16 draft beer lines. The ground floor also features screened booths, a snug and banquette seating.

Stairway to pizza
A spiral staircase leads to the first floor, where a pizza kitchen with an Italian corner oven takes centre stage, visible through glazed screens.
The design combines reclaimed timber walls, decorated ceilings and original architectural details.
Seating includes both leather banquettes and benches, with views across Fargate and towards Sheffield’s City Hall.
